Results From Cuba's Referendum On Its New Constitution To Be Announced Today



Reuters: Cubans appear to ratify new socialist constitution

HAVANA, Feb 25 (Reuters) - Cubans appear to have overwhelmingly ratified a new constitution that enshrines the one-party socialist system as irrevocable while instituting modest economic and social changes.

Results from Sunday's constitutional referendum, which saw over 80 percent of the 8.7 million electorate cast ballots, were expected Monday afternoon.

There are no exit polls in Cuba, but citizens could observe the count after the polls closed in their neighborhoods.

Cuba's best-known dissident and pioneer blogger, Yoani Sanchez, who runs an online newspaper from a barrio known for its support of the government, wrote she braved insults and yelling to witness the count in her precinct of 400 yes votes and just 25 no votes.
